- Rhinitis, Allergic Rhinitis, Chronic Rhinosinusitis, Nasal Endoscopy, Rhinitis Symptom The 22 adolescents with symptoms of CRS more often had allergic rhinitis symptoms (57.1% vs 28.1%, p=0.003) asthma (25.0% vs 11.0%, p=0.047) and cough >= 3 months (13.6% vs 3.4%, p=0.008) compared to those without symptoms of CRS.
